Argo lost against Lyons back in March of 2024, and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Saturday. The Argonauts took a 2-0 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Lions. The Argonauts have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-21, 25-14.
Sebastian Pardol paced Argo's offense, picking up seven kills. Pardol got some help from Alexander Jakowicki and his nine assists.
Argo's loss dropped their record down to 6-4. As for Lyons, the win keeps they at an undefeated 5-0.
Argo has already played their next match, a 2-0 victory against Oak Lawn on the 5th. As for Lyons, they will challenge Oak Park-River Forest at 5:30 p.m. on Tuesday. The Huskies will roll in looking for their eighth straight win, something the Lions surely won't give up without a fight.
